The Support Centre for Open Resources in Education (SCORE) is inviting applications for Short-Term Fellowships. These are designed for people with little or no experience of Open Educational Resources (OER) and will provide a thorough grounding in both production and use of OER. The Fellowship consists of distance learning elements and a one week intensive residential course in Milton Keynes. Further details and an application form can be found at http://www8.open.ac.uk/score/news/short-term-fellowship-score-december. The closing date for applications is 21 October 2010.
